  2. Carry On Henry is a 1971 British historical comedy film, the 21st release in the series of 31 Carry On films (1958–1992). It tells a fictionalised story involving Sid James as Henry VIII, who chases after Barbara Windsor 's character Bettina. James and Windsor feature alongside other regulars Kenneth Williams, Charles Hawtrey, Joan ...

  4. Heinrichs Bettgeschichten oder Wie der Knoblauch nach England kam parodiert wieder einmal einen historischen Stoff. In den USA wurde der Film unter dem Titel Carry On Henry VIII verliehen. Der Produktionstitel war Anne of a Thousand Lays in Anlehnung an den Film Königin für tausend Tage.

  7. The 21st film of the long running Carry On series is a bawdy trip into the court of King Henry VIII (Sid James). The King has recently married Queen Marie of Normandy (Joan Sims) but since she eats too much garlic, thus putting the King off his conjugal rights, he plots to get her out the way.
